## Runbook: replica lag alarm (Pondera DB)

So this one pages more than it should. The read replica in the Varrowdale region trails primary during the hourly analytics dump, trips the lag alarm, then recovers on its own about 90% of the time. Before you silence anything: check whether the dump job is still running, confirm replication threads are alive, and only fail over if lag keeps climbing past ten minutes. Escalate to the data platform rotation otherwise. The alarm thresholds are driven by the values below.

deployment values, kajep-kageg:
[praix]
host = praix.paliqcorp.corp
user = praix_svc
database = praix_prod

# Break-Glass: Tripwire Circuit Breaker (Orlop Upstream API)

If the Orlop API starts flapping hard enough that the Tripwire breaker won't reset on its own, you can force it open manually. Yes, this bypasses the cooldown — that's the point. Hit the breaker console, pick the stuck shard, and confirm. The console will prompt for the override passphrase, which is kept right below.

recovery phrase for bajog-kadug: lamion-novdor-oliix-belox-nordor-praeth-sorael

Ticket: Intermittent connection failures in the Holloway Museum audio-guide app (project Echotrail). For new team members: the app streams tour audio and syncs listener progress to the visits store every 30 seconds. Since Tuesday, roughly 4% of sync attempts fail with pool-exhaustion errors, mostly during peak gallery hours. We suspect the connection pool ceiling is too low for weekend traffic. Please verify pool metrics before changing limits. To inspect the visits store directly, use the connection string below.

database URL for tajog-bajeg: mysql://soreth_svc:OzsCjhu@db-6997.nelvrostack.internal:5432/kelax

## Runbook: Account recovery during Norwick DNS flaps

When the Norwick resolver pool flaps, account-recovery emails fail silently because the Tallowmere mailer cannot resolve upstream MX records. Symptoms: recovery queue depth climbing, no bounce records.

Steps: pin the mailer to the static resolver set, flush the negative cache, replay the stuck queue. Confirm delivery with a canary recovery request. If the admin console is also unreachable, use the emergency login, which accepts the passphrase below.

unlock words, bafof-hahof: druael-ralwyn